-You do not have to spend a lot to be a green energy consumer. You can just change your habits and be green. You can certainly save big by driving the speed limit and not over use your gas pedal. You can save as much as 20 percent on gas if you just follow those two rules. 
- 
-Using green energies is not an excuse to use more energy than you really need. Do not forget to turn the lights off when you leave a room and putting on a sweater instead of turning the heat up. Even if green energies are cheaper, you should still do your best to save as much energy as you can. 
- 
-Use less energy for cooking your meals by baking several items together. You can bake cakes, bread and pies once each week and avoid heating your oven very often. Making larger batches of food on top of the stove also helps. You can make large pots of soups and stews, and freeze some for microwaving later.

-When finishing up your work for the day, turn off your home office equipment including your computer. These modern work machines eat up a lot of energy, even when not in use. Taking the initiative to shut them down completely can save a lot of energy and money for you! 
- 
-One key energy-saving tip that all homeowners would be wise to implement is to insulate your water heater tanks. A great deal of heat can be lost if a tank is not well insulated, resulting in higher-energy consumption Makes sure you wrap your tank to help keep your water warm.

-Invest in a tankless water heater. Rather than a standard water heater, which is working 24 hours a day, a tankless water heater provides hot water only when you need it. This will save you about $100 to $200 per year, up to 50% less than the cost of running a standard water heater.
